Layout change
I am preparing an excel data sheet that contains data for each month in a year.
Currently, the data for each project month runs horizontally across the page like this: January February March I would like to change the data to read this way: January February March Because there is so much data, I didn't want to have to re-enter the information, just change the layout with out using a pivot table. Any ideas? Thanks. |

Layout change
CopyPaste SpecialTranspose.
Paste area must not overlap copied area. Note: if using Excel version earlier than 2007 you are limited to 256 rows of transpose to columns. Excel 2007 has 16384 columns.
